ZIP code 95128 is located in San Jose, California, within Santa Clara County. With a population of 33,585, this is a moderately populated ZIP code with a middle-aged community — the median age is 38.8 years. Economically, 95128 is a upper-middle-income ZIP code: the median household income of $122,647 is significantly above the national average.
Real estate in ZIP code 95128 represents among the most expensive housing markets in the country. The median home value of $1,214,500 is more than double the national average. Renters can expect to pay around $2,505 per month in median rent. The area has a relatively balanced mix of owners (44.3%) and renters (55.7%). Median home values have increased by 34% since 2019.
The population of 95128 is racially diverse, with White as the largest group at 38.2%. Residents are highly educated — 60.7% hold a bachelor's degree or higher, which is significantly above the national average. Poverty affects a relatively small share of residents at 9.2%. Household income has grown by 31% since 2019.
The unemployment rate in 95128 stands at 3.4%, which is below the national average. About 19% of workers are remote. As in most parts of the country, driving alone is the dominant commute mode at 67%.
Overall, ZIP code 95128 in San Jose, CA is characterized as upper-middle-income, highly educated, and a middle-aged community. With 33,585 residents, a median household income of $122,647, and a median home value of $1,214,500, it offers a clear picture of life in this part of California.
